The 2024 Nashville SC season was the fifth season for Nashville SC as a member of Major League Soccer (MLS), the top flight of professional soccer in the United States. As runners-up in the 2023 Leagues Cup , they earned a berth to compete in the 2024 CONCACAF Champions Cup opening the season against Dominican club Moca FC . [ 2 ]
Nashville SC's original organized supporter group is The Roadies. Established in February 2014 with the creation of Nashville FC, the city's NPSL amateur franchise with the club's transition from NPSL amateur to USL pro status and finally MLS, The Roadies similarly transitioned to maintain their support for "Our Town, Our Club". On December 20, 2017, Nashville was selected as MLS' 24th franchise. [11] The MLS team began play in 2020. [11] On February 10, 2018, Nashville SC competed in their first game; a preseason exhibition match against Atlanta United FC of MLS. [12] In the rain-soaked contest, Nashville was defeated by Atlanta, 3–1, in front of 9,059 spectators. [13]

Nashville SC is the name for two related soccer teams based in Nashville, Tennessee. Initially, Nashville SC (2018–19) competed in the USL Championship for two seasons before its expansion to MLS, joining as Nashville SC in 2020. Nashville SC is an American soccer club founded in 2017, after the city of Nashville was awarded a Major League Soccer (MLS) franchise. Nashville SC began playing competitive soccer in the 2020 season. It plays its home games at Geodis Park, competing in the Eastern Conference of MLS.
